Description : From 1919 to 1933, the Weimar Republic was the government of what nation? -History

Last Answer : Weimar Republic, the government of Germany from 1919 to 1933, so called because the assembly that adopted its constitution met at Weimar from February 6 to August 11, 1919.

Description : Why did american liberty league view the new deal as unconstitutional and un-american?

Last Answer : The American Liberty League charged the New Deal with limiting individual freedom in an unconstitutional, "un-American" manner. To them, programs such as compulsory unemployment insurance smacked of "Bolshevism," a reference to the political philosophy of the founders of the Soviet Union.

Description : What do you know about the Rowlatt Act of 1919? -SST 10th

Last Answer : This Act had been passed through the imperial legislative council despite the united opposition of the Indian members. It gave the British government enormous powers to repress political activities and allowed detention of political prisoners.
